The Pakistan Cricket Board decided to postpone Pakistan Super League with immediate effect after three fresh COVID-19 cases took the toll to seven on Thursday. PCB released a press release on PSL website to confirm the development.
"Following a meeting with the team owners and considering the health and wellbeing of all participants is paramount, the Pakistan Cricket Board has decided to postpone the HBL Pakistan Super League 6 with immediate effect," read PCB's statement. "The decision was made after seven cases were reported in the competition, which had started on 20 February." | ||||||||
